Output 31a7934a343af6c492b39ed24000935086d34e1aa8fb412d61cd78fd0621ac33:58

value
43502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e9f7f023290202ad5501213260a2cd28e6539b OP_EQUAL
address
3NvYyTweguKsGgfMWp5LEhr24L52ws8n5h
transaction
31a7934a343af6c492b39ed24000935086d34e1aa8fb412d61cd78fd0621ac33
spent
true